A little late in posting this but comedian Greg Giraldo has passed away from an accidental overdose. Giraldo was 44, and known for his Celebrity Roasts of has-been celebrities like David Hasselhoff and Jerry Springer. I first knew about Greg when he was a frequent guest on Comedy Central’s Tough Crowd with Colin Quinn. We even did an interview with him back in 2005 as well, which you can read here. I also reviewed his latest stand-up Midlife Vices last October. He started out as a lawyer before changing careers, and was a guest on Lewis Black’s show, as well as a judge on Last Comic Standing. His funny roasts and stand-ups will be sorely missed!

Comedian Greg Giraldo — well-known for his work on such programs as Tough Crowd with Colin Quinn, Lewis Black’s Root of All Evil, several Comedy Central roasts, and NBC’s Last Comic Standing — has passed away. Both Comedy Central and NBC confirmed the comedian died Wednesday in a New Brunswick, N.J., hospital, just days after being hospitalized, reportedly for a prescription pill overdose.
